More about the book

The book examines the inefficiencies and capacity constraints of Chinese Railways, which hinder economic growth despite their size. It advocates for a comprehensive reform program, highlighting the potential benefits of moderate deregulation, particularly in the freight sector. Operational enhancements, including schedule redesign and value-added services, are also recommended. Drawing on expert interviews and comparisons with rail systems in the US, Germany, Russia, and Japan, the author provides actionable strategies for a turnaround to support China's GDP growth.
